The cost of fragmented permitting

Traditional government permitting processes are strained by outdated workflows and disconnected systems. These challenges can create delays, increase risk, and undermine both economic progress and public trust. 

McKinsey & Company Opens in a new tab estimates that it takes between four and five years for the average capital investment dollar to get through the federal permitting process, suggesting there’s $1.1 trillion to $1.5 trillion of infrastructure capital expenditure currently tied up in federal permitting.

Today, agencies face several persistent issues:

  • Fragmented processes: Permitting data is scattered across siloed agency systems, with manual handoffs and “sign and forget” workflows, that limit transparency and accountability. 

  • Economic impact: Delays in permitting slow housing development, clean energy deployment, and infrastructure projects, increasing costs and delaying investment from public and private stakeholders.

  • Poor constituent experience: Applicants often face black hole processes with little visibility into application status, next steps, or timelines, leading to frustration and uncertainty.Together, these issues increase administrative burden for agencies while making it harder to deliver timely, predictable, and equitable public services.

The three pillars of modern permitting

Permitting reform efforts at the federal, state, and local levels are focused on reducing delays, improving transparency, and accelerating outcomes in areas like housing, infrastructure, and energy. While policy changes set the direction, real progress depends on how agencies execute day-to-day permitting work. Modern permitting requires a connected approach that supports the full lifecycle of a permit, from application through oversight.

A modern permitting model is built on three core pillars:

  • Pillar 1 – Smart generation through better creation: Modern permitting depends on getting applications right the first time. Digital web forms with conditional logic guide applicants through only the fields required for their specific permit. By validating information and ensuring completeness before submission, agencies receive applications that are ready for review, reducing rework, limiting delays, and speeding up overall timelines.

  • Pillar 2 – Frictionless commitment across stakeholders: Permitting often involves multiple departments such as fire, zoning, environmental, and legal teams. Secure identity verification and automated routing ensure permits reach the right reviewers quickly. Stakeholders can review, approve, and sign digitally with clear visibility into status, reducing delays caused by manual handoffs and disconnected systems.

  • Pillar 3 – Continuous oversight through intelligent management: Permitting continues long after a permit is issued. Agencies must track expirations, renewals, amendments, and compliance obligations across large permit portfolios. AI-powered repositories help surface key data, monitor deadlines, and maintain oversight to support compliance, accountability, and long-term program effectiveness.

Together, these three pillars create a modern permitting foundation that replaces fragmented workflows with a connected, transparent, and scalable approach to public service delivery.

A practical roadmap to implementation

Modernizing permitting does not require a massive, instant transformation. Agencies can make meaningful progress by taking a phased and deliberate approach that helps reduce risk, build confidence, and deliver measurable value earlier in the process.

A successful implementation roadmap typically includes three key steps:

  1. Start with an audit: Map current permitting workflows to identify manual steps, handoffs, and points where applications slow or stall. This helps agencies focus on the bottlenecks that most impact speed, accuracy, and transparency.

  2. Launch with a focused pilot: Begin with one high-impact permit type, such as residential solar or small business licensing. A targeted pilot allows teams to test workflows, refine processes, and demonstrate results without disrupting ongoing operations.

  3. Prioritize change management and staff empowerment: Remove repetitive administrative work so staff can focus on review, decision-making, and constituent support. Clear communication, training, and early wins help drive adoption and long-term success.
